Cintas Wins 2012 UNIVATOR Award for Fourth Consecutive Year

Cintas Corporation (NASDAQ: CTAS), a world leader in corporate
identify uniforms, announced it has won a 2012 UNIVATOR Award for
its innovative, corporate-wide uniform redesign for McDonald’s
Canada. Sponsored by UniformMarket News, the UNIVATOR Awards
recognize forward-thinking companies that have developed innovative
apparel programs, products and strategies over the past year. One
of only eight companies to win a 2012 UNIVATOR Award, Cintas won in
the “Uniform Program Innovation” category.

Created as part of a multi-year $1 billion makeover to modernize
the majority of its more than 1,400 McDonald’s restaurants in
Canada, the new uniforms were designed to complement the
restaurants’ new contemporary interiors, which feature flat screen
televisions, fireplaces and comfortable seating. To give the
restaurants a more inviting and current look, Fourmy exchanged the
traditional polo for a modern “wedge” polo and paired sleek, black
silhouettes with small splashes of color. Reflective piping in crew
uniforms was added to match the stainless steel used within all
interiors and provide visibility at night for employee safety.

To accommodate McDonald’s request for improved sustainability,
Cintas used environmentally-friendly fabrics, such as recycled
polyester and renewable bamboo fibers, to create the uniforms. In
addition, many of the garments can be returned to Cintas at the end
of their wearable lives to be “down cycled,” a process which
transforms the uniforms into other usable fabrics to help reduce
landfill waste.

About Cintas:
Headquartered in Cincinnati, Cintas Corporation provides highly
specialized services to businesses of all types primarily
throughout North America. Cintas designs, manufactures and
implements corporate identity uniform programs, and provides
entrance mats, restroom supplies, promotional products, first aid,
safety, fire protection products and services and document
management services for approximately 900,000 businesses. Cintas is
a publicly held company traded over the Nasdaq Global Select Market
under the symbol CTAS, and is a component of the Standard &
Poor’s 500 Index.
